Pondless Water Features: WaterfallsWaterfalls are popular pondless water features, and there are numerous design options. If space is limited, these pondless water features can simply consist of a single, large waterfall that flows over a flat rock. Or, waterfalls can consist of a stream and several levels of large rocks and boulders that create numerous, small cascades before the final and largest waterfall at the bottom. |

Pondless Water Features: Garden FountainsFountains are pondless water features that are suitable for even the smallest of spaces. There are basically two types of fountains: garden fountains and wall fountains. Garden fountains are free-standing structures. Some simply shoot sprays or jets of water into a small pool. Other types of these pondless water features consist of several tiers. Water fills one tier, and then spills into the next, until it reaches the bottom and is transported back to the top. Some have a very traditional design, with smaller circles stacked above larger ones; others incorporate the use of sculptures or urns. |

Pondless Water Features: Wall FountainsWall fountains are the smallest pondless water features. They can be affixed to walls and other outdoor structures, and are really more of an accent than a focal point. Like garden fountains, these pondless water features can contain tiers or simply spray a stream of water into a collecting area. They can be made of stone, fiberglass, or metal and a variety of designs are available. |

Pondless Water Features and Landscape DesignBefore you install any pondless water features, it’s important to ensure they will work well with your landscape design. You want your waterfall or fountain to complement your landscape, not overwhelm it. For example, if you have a stone walkway leading to your garden, consider a wall or garden fountain that matches this material. If you’ve used rocks to construct retaining walls, using similarly-sized and colored rocks in your waterfall will provide balance and unity in your landscape.
